Child and Adolescent Mental Health: A Guide for Practice (Electronic book text)


This text examines an area of practice that will appeal to a broad range of mental health professionals working in any context with children, adolescents and young people who have or are at risk of developing mental health problems. It covers the wider policy and legal context of child and adolescent mental health problems, incorporating up to date information on the organisation and delivery of services for this group of young people. Definitions and prevalence of various mental health problems will be elucidated and underpinned by contemporary quantitative data concerning signs, symptoms and resilience factors.
